Team — the Merrowline dedupe cut-over finished Saturday night. All customer records from the old Cardstack store were merged through the new matcher; 412k duplicates collapsed, zero hard conflicts. Rollback window closed Monday. Known quirk: fuzzy matching on transliterated names is disabled until the scoring model is retrained, so expect a few stragglers. The old pipeline is frozen, not deleted — do not revive it. Everything the matcher needs at runtime is pinned; the active configuration is reproduced below.

settings of yagap-bagaf:
[norael]
team = druion
access_code = ac_2a164a
host = norael.novacsys.internal
port = 6379
owner = fenael.istdor
peer = belius.nelvrosys.corp

Subject: Regional Sales Review — Heads Up

Team, quick note before Thursday. The Varenfield region beat target again; Corsley lagged, mostly on the Lumet range. We'll walk the numbers at the review and agree corrective steps. Please have your department summaries ready. One item won't be discussed openly — the confidential plan is included below.

management briefing: Project Ulavan slips by two quarters because of the staffing delay.

## Runbook: Thumbnail Queue Backlog

When the Pixelbarn thumbnail generation queue backs up, start by checking worker health before scaling anything. Most backlogs come from oversized source images stalling a single worker, not from genuine load. Restart the stalled worker first, then confirm the queue depth is falling over five minutes. If it is not, scale the worker pool by one and re-check. Do not purge the queue without sign-off from the media team lead. The queue's current configuration values are listed below.

deployment values, yadup-kadug:
[sorys]
port = 5672
team = noveth
host = sorys.orvexcorp.example
region = south-4
access_code = ac_deddc1
timeout_ms = 1500